ELECTRICAL CHARACTERISTICS
Capacitance range Cn2.6µF to 612µF
Tolerance on Cn±10%
Nominal DC voltage range 6500V to 56kV (up to 100kV on specific design)
Operating hot-spot temperature range -55ºC to 85°C
Lifetime @ Vnand 70°C hot-spot temperature 100,000 hours
Test voltage between terminals 1.5Vnduring 10s
Test voltage between shorten terminals and case 1.5Vnduring 10s
APPLICATIONS
DC voltage filtering for:
DC link
Resonant filtering
Active correction (FACTS)
HVDC
High Power DC Supply
PRESENTATION
PACKAGING
Rectangular stainless steel case.
Grounding is via a nut on top of the case.
